Iterative algorithm for reconstruction of entangled states

An iterative algorithm for the reconstruction of an unknown quantum state from the results of incompatible measurements is proposed. It consists of an expectation-maximization step followed by a unitary transformation of the eigenbasis of the density matrix. The procedure has been applied to the reconstruction of the entangled pair of photons.
